Output 43ff8eaf23130effc58a5b04e771241801a0cb897e076ed0f732f16e9ac0458e:1

value
544985
script pubkey
OP_0 OP_PUSHBYTES_20 e57324587a7f10599193e2d70948ce1e2bf9fb58
address
bc1qu4ejgkr60ug9nyvnuttsjjxwrc4ln76ck097n5
transaction
43ff8eaf23130effc58a5b04e771241801a0cb897e076ed0f732f16e9ac0458e
spent
true